Have you e-mailed the moderators? It would be a good thing to know what the complaint was so that you don't make the same mistake again. Besides, often things can be rectified with clarification or apology and you could be unbanned.
A forum I moderate had to ban all input from a large college in southern California earlier this year because of intrusion hacking of our server. Of course this resulted in an unannounced disruption for our regular members from that same region, but their banning was coincidental to the problem. Once the university caught the persons responsable, we were able to unban the IP address' and return to business as usual. _________________ 'The question of whether computers can think is like the question of whether submarines can swim.' - Edsgar Dijkstra |

I agree, what a moderator says goes. But I encounter so many people who forget that moderators are people, people in authority, but people none the less. They can be spoken with like any other human (except, perhaps, the Queen of England). I know learning to just talk to people in authority is difficult. I have an incredibly hard time doing so myself, but it is a necessary life skill. Often the first step is to get used to talking to those people who can only have a small impact in our lives, like a forum moderator.
I always advise that new players read not only the rules/FAQ but also several threads on a new board, to get a good feel for what is considered socially acceptable in that community.  _________________ 'The question of whether computers can think is like the question of whether submarines can swim.' - Edsgar Dijkstra |
